Bereavement Program
In a safe and supportive atmosphere, the Bereavement Program offers the grieving of Melrose and nearby communities the opportunity to come together, learn about the many facets of grief, acknowledge their loss, listen to others, support one another, pray together, remember their loved ones, accept different feelings, learn to cope and find a new role in life moving forward with hope.
Meeting Location:
Parish Center Living Room
Ministry Leader:
Patricia McConville
Objective:
To support those who have recently experienced the death of a loved one.
Duties/Responsibilities:
- publicize program/contact bereaved
- listen in phone interview
- provide support and referrals
- create a safe, welcoming environment
- present topics, facilitate discussion, share resources
- provide refreshments
- be available for additional support
Qualifications:
- some pastoral training, particularly in grief issues
- hospice and/or social work background helpful
Training:
Suggest archdiocesan course and/or hospice training
Time of Ministry:
Spring and Fall 6-week program on Monday evenings, 7:30-9:00pm
Length of Commitment:
As available
